Trevardo Williams lasted less than a week in Arizona.

Williams, the linebacker chosen by the Texans in the fourth round of last year’s draft, was waived by the Texans a week ago and picked up by the Cardinals. And now the Cardinals have cut Williams as well.

The Cardinals feel good enough about their depth at linebacker that they’re already paring down the position, having also cut Ernie Sims this week. Williams must not have done anything to impress during his brief stint in Arizona.

With two teams cutting him in a week, Williams now looks like a long shot to land anywhere. This 2013 fourth-round pick may be done without ever setting foot on the field for an NFL game.
